We're currently looking for an experienced social worker to join our Adoption Support Team within Adoption, Lancashire & Blackpool (ALB) which is a Regional Adoption Agency, hosted by Lancashire County Council (LCC). ALB delivers the Family Finding, Recruitment & Assessment and Adoption Support on behalf of the two authorities. This post is advertised as a grade 8/9, with the possibility of the successful candidate being appointed as a senior social worker practitioner subject to experience, knowledge and skills.
Our Adoption Support Team provides support to families affected by adoption across Lancashire and Blackpool. This includes support to birth families and adopted adults. Our team offers a range of support from training workshops, social events as well as one to one support to children and their families. We also support adopted adults in understanding their early life history. This role is a permanent, full-time position.

It is an exciting time for service, and in particular Adoption Support, where we have created our Adoption Communities and our Therapeutic Service. Our Adoption Community includes peer groups for adopted children, young people and their parents, specialist workshops and developing a peer buddying and mentoring offer, which you will host alongside our team members. In addition to this, you will be responsible for promoting our therapeutic service with our families with potential to co-deliver some of these workshops.
